Na Gaeil 6-15 Corofin 1-12 ANOTHER game, another historic moment for Na Gaeil. Just two years after winning the Munster and All-Ireland Junior Club titles, the Tralee side have added Intermediate silverware to the cabinet and they did so in some style this afternoon against the Clare champions in Mallow. KERRY received three football All-Stars this evening. Fossa brothers David and Paudie Clifford along with Dingle’s Tom O’Sullivan received the awards announced on RTE this evening. Missing out were other Kingdom nominees Seánie O’Shea, David Moran, Brian Ó Beaglaoich and Gavin White.
